Transaction 62080709a2fd438fefe198e1af4e5381407575e01ce6c9edc877f681eaf64ffb

5 Input
1 Outputs
  • 62080709a2fd438fefe198e1af4e5381407575e01ce6c9edc877f681eaf64ffb:0
  • value  3247000000
    address  3CXDushn59iAxfejBjxv92jn6iT2zS1Pti